
Child Shooter Brags About Attack, Affidavit Reveals
A 6-year-old boy who shot his teacher in January at a Virginia elementary school later boasted about it, according to unsealed search warrants. The teacher survived the incident but suffered gunshot wounds to her hand and chest. The documents also revealed a previous incident where the same child apparently choked a different teacher. The child's family claims he has extreme emotional issues and is receiving therapy. The mother of the student has pleaded guilty to federal gun charges and will be sentenced in October.
